All preschoolers love bubbles, and it is very simple to make your own. Here are the ingredients:


1/2 gallon of water
1/2 cup of Dawn or Joy dishwashing liquid
1/4 cup of glycerine


Mix the ingredients together in a wide container being careful not to make foam. If the solution becomes too foamy, wait a few minutes to allow it to settle. When you are finished, store the solution in a sealed container. The solution will get better with time.


Glycerine, or glycerin, can usually be found in most drug stores. It is essential to prevent the bubbles from breaking too quickly. If it is not available, try adding 1/4 cup of corn syrup or 1 tbsp of sugar to the solution instead.
